Course structure

• Introduction to Paint Preservation Techniques
• Chemistry of Paints and Coatings
• Surface Preparation and Cleaning Methods
• Environmental Factors in Paint Degradation
• Advanced Conservation Strategies
• Documentation and Condition Assessment
• Ethical Considerations in Paint Preservation
• Hands-On Application and Restoration Practices
• Preventive Conservation and Maintenance Planning
• Case Studies in Paint Preservation Projects

Career path

Paint Conservation Specialist

Experts in preserving historical and artistic paintwork, ensuring longevity and authenticity. High demand in museums and heritage sites.

Industrial Coatings Inspector

Professionals inspecting and maintaining protective coatings in industrial settings, ensuring compliance with safety standards.

Restoration Technician

Skilled technicians restoring damaged paintwork in buildings, vehicles, and artworks, blending traditional and modern techniques.
